[HOMEGROWN WATCH] The Los Angeles Galaxy and FC Dallas called in their homegrown chips to sign two of the most highly regarded forwards in the college ranks. The Galaxy signed 21-year-old Gyasi Zardes, who scored 38 goals during a three-year college career at CSU Bakersfield, while FC Dallas added Bradlee ... Read the whole story

[DATEBOOK] The U.S. women's national team will open the 2013 season under new coach Tom Sermanni with a two-game series against Scotland -- his native country -- in the Southeast. After a game in Jacksonville on Feb. 9, the teams will meet four days later at LP Field in Nashville, ... Read the whole story
